Dalam TappingMode, probe berosilasi pada frekuensi resonansi fundamental dengan posisi vertikal dari tip (atau sampel) kemudian disesuaikan untuk mempertahankan amplitude osilasi yang konstan saat probe melakukan scan melewati surface.<\/p>\n\n\n\n<p>Sayangnya, Tapping Mode menghasilkan resolusi gambar lebih rendah dibandingkan Contact Mode AFM. Untuk itu, faktor utama dalam meraih hasil gambar AFM berkualitas tinggi membutuhkan kontrol gaya interaksi antara probe dan sampel selama proses imaging.<\/p>\n\n\n\n<p>Tahun 2010, Bruker memperkenalkan PeakForce Tapping Mode dalam AFM. Metode yang digunakan secara luas dalam penelitian biomolekuler sebab kemampuannya menghasilkan gambar beresolusi tinggi secara konsisten. <\/p>\n\n\n\n<p>Pada PeakForce Tapping, jarak antara probe dan sampel dimodulasi secara sinusoidal dengan mempertahankan gaya maksimum antara keduanya.<\/p>\n\n\n<div class=\"wp-block-image\">\n<figure class=\"aligncenter size-full\"><img fetchpriority=\"high\" decoding=\"async\" width=\"446\" height=\"242\" src=\"https:\/\/dynatech-int.com\/wp-content\/uploads\/2023\/06\/imaging-of-DNA.png\" alt=\"PeakForce Tapping Mode the AFM probe is modulated at low frequency\" class=\"wp-image-8271\" srcset=\"https:\/\/dynatech-int.com\/wp-content\/uploads\/2023\/06\/imaging-of-DNA.png 446w, https:\/\/dynatech-int.com\/wp-content\/uploads\/2023\/06\/imaging-of-DNA-300x163.png 300w, https:\/\/dynatech-int.com\/wp-content\/uploads\/2023\/06\/imaging-of-DNA-18x10.png 18w\" sizes=\"(max-width: 446px) 100vw, 446px\" \/><figcaption class=\"wp-element-caption\">Gambar 1.  In PeakForce Tapping Mode the AFM probe is modulated at low frequency (1-2 kHz). (A) As the probe is brought into contact with the surface, the feedback signal is the maximum or \u201cpeak\u201d force applied to the surface. (B) If the motion of the probe is considered in terms of Z position, one is essentially performing a force curve at every position of the sample surface<\/figcaption><\/figure><\/div>\n\n\n<p>Feedback loop waktu secara nyata digunakan untuk mengontrol posisi probe dan penggunaan sinusoidal ramping sehingga kecepatan scanning lebih tinggi. Bahkan, teknologi PeakForce Tapping menggunakaan mode imaging ScanAsyst yang mengoptimalisasi setpoint imaging secara otomatis.<\/p>\n\n\n\n<h2 class=\"wp-block-heading\" id=\"h-metode-peakforce-tapping-mode-pada-dna\">Metode PeakForce Tapping Mode pada DNA<\/h2>\n\n\n\n<p>Metode PeakForce Tapping Mode berhasil melakukan imaging DNA dengan resolusi tinggi. PeakForce Tapping image of groove depth variations in the DNA plasmid topography obtained using the FastScan Bio AFM and FastScan-D probes (small cantilever and standard silicon tip). (A) Low-magnification AFM topography image of a plasmid showing corrugation. The white rectangle indicates the area imaged in B. (B) Higher-magnification trace (white arrow to right) and retrace (white arrow to left) images of this area showing corrugation consistent with the B form of DNA, for consecutive images. (C) Trace (solid) and retrace (dashed) height profiles taken along straight lines as indicated in B, closely following the backbone of the four plasmid scans and averaged over a 5 -pixel (~0.5) width. The height profiles confirm the observed corrugation to be the alternating major and minor grooves of double helix structure and that these grooves vary in depth along the DNA strand. The height profiles have been offset by multiples of 0.6 nm for clarity. Color scales: 3.5 nm (A), 1.1 nm (B).
